CNA jobs in Brookneal reflect overall patterns seen throughout south-central Virginia rather than city-specific hiring trends due to its smaller population size. In the Lynchburg region, approximately 1,180 certified nursing assistants fill vital roles supporting patient care at various types of health facilities nearby.
CNA salary in Brookneal generally follows regional benchmarks since localized city data is unavailable. In the Lynchburg region, CNAs earn around $35,780 per year or about $17.20 per hour according to BLS OEWS (May 2023). This is slightly below Virginia's statewide median annual salary of $36,820 but still represents stable earnings potential within this part of the state’s healthcare sector.
The primary CMS-certified facility located directly within Brookneal is Heritage Hall - Brookneal—a notable employer with capacity for up to 60 residents and an average occupancy near that level—where newly certified CNAs may find rewarding entry points into clinical practice after completing their training requirements locally.

Requirements to Work as a CNA in Brookneal, VA
To work as a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) in Brookneal, you must meet the statewide CNA requirements set by Virginia. These include completing a Virginia Board of Nursing–approved Nurse Aide Education Program, passing both parts of the National Nurse Aide Assessment Program (NNAAP) exam administered by Credentia, and being listed on the Virginia Nurse Aide Registry.
- At least 120 total hours of training (80 classroom + 40 clinical hours)
- At least 24 hours of classroom instruction before any direct resident contact
- Passing both the knowledge and skills exams within 24 months of completing training (up to three attempts per section)
- Criminal background check per Code of Virginia § 32.1-162.9:1
- Placement on the Virginia Nurse Aide Registry maintained by the Virginia Board of Nursing
Once certified, you can work in hospitals, nursing homes, rehabilitation centers, and home health agencies throughout Brookneal and across Virginia.

Career Growth & Advancement
Many CNAs use their experience as a stepping stone toward advanced healthcare careers:
- Specialized certifications (e.g., dementia care, medication aide)
- Promotion into shift supervisor or training coordinator roles
- Bridge programs to become an LPN or RN
- Opportunities in healthcare administration or education
